Why are these Boom Cards great for you and your students?

Benefits for teachers:

  • save on paper: the cards work on tablets, Chromebooks, computers, any mobile device, even smartphones, no printing involved. You can even project from your computer onto a screen.
  • save on prep time: you can use the cards immediately and you don’t need any fancy software. Access the cards from the Boom Learning Website or on the Boom Cards app (Apple Store or Google Play).
  • save on grading time: the cards are self-grading and the program offers you performance reports so you can see how well your kids are doing.
  • resources for your specific needs: you can create your own cards with the tools the website offers, which are easy to use, or you can purchase decks.
  • opportunities for differentiation: you can assign different decks of cards for different groups of students
  • homework alternative: students can use the cards at home because students have their own accounts, so you can assign decks as homework.

Benefits for students:

  • the practice is engaging and challenging: there’s a gaming aspect to the cards – students earn points and badges for using the cards and getting the right answers
  • the feedback is immediate: they learn right away if what they’re answering is right or wrong
  • best of all, it’s interactive, colorful, and fun!

Creating your own Boom Cards

With an account, even a free one, you can also create your own cards. The set of drag and drop tools available on the platform allows anyone to make cards.

The cool thing is that anything can be an answer: a letter, a word, an image, anything that is clickable can be an answer. You can also embed YouTube videos on the cards and have students answer questions about it.
